A kaleidoscope is a cylinder full of broken pieces, yet everyone still stares at it in awe. Who's to say the same can't be said for women? Before being thrust into the violent and terrifying sex trafficking industry, I lived in a tiny hamlet in my home country of Czechia. I had an unfulfilling yet peaceful life before I drew the eye of a royal-blooded aristocrat who took what he wanted and lived without consequences. For six years, I am beaten, tortured, and exploited, yet my shoulders never carry the weight of my abuse. My heart does, which is precisely what Trey Corbyn plays on when he spots me from afar seconds after I am released from captivity. He sees past my frail skin, hollow eyes, and waif-thin exterior. He sees a survivor. A woman. Someone as broken as him. With his instincts no longer in existence and his possessiveness dangerous, will this broken man fix me? Or will his insecurities worsen my cracks until they become unfixable? Trey: European Redemption is a gritty story about finding love in the darkest places. It's raw and intimidating, and it shows that even when you've been beaten to believe otherwise, sometimes dreams do come true. This book has violent scenes that may be distressing to some readers. Caution is advised. It is book seven in the Russian Mob Chronicles, however, it can be read as a standalone. * For TWs, please visit the author's website.
